What Are Freight Containers?
Freight containers, also referred to as shipping containers, are standardized, multiple-use vessels for transferring items and products. Built primarily from steel and aluminum, these containers are created to stand up to severe environmental conditions while guaranteeing the safety and security of their contents. Their standardization has reinvented the Shipping Container Cabin industry, helping with intermodal transport-- moving containers seamlessly from ships to trucks to trains without unloading the products.

The Role of Freight Containers in Global Trade
Freight containers have actually substantially changed international trade. Their standardization permits several Shipping Container Transport and transport modes to team up without dealing with compatibility issues. Some essential roles freight containers play include:
- Efficient Transportation: Containers enable the effective loading, discharging, and transfer of products throughout several transport modes, reducing time spent in transit.
- Cost-Efficiency: Their uniform size allows effective usage of area, leading to lower shipping expenses. Shipping companies can transport more items in each journey, decreasing general shipping expenditures.
- Security: Containers use a safe environment for items, lessening the risk of theft or damage throughout transit. Their sealed design avoids tampering.
- Ecologically Friendly: By optimizing transport routes and logistics, containers contribute to lower carbon emissions, making freight transport more sustainable.
The Impact of Technology on Freight Containers
As innovation continues to develop, so too does the landscape of freight containers. Here are several technological improvements affecting their usage:
- IoT Integration: The Internet of Things (IoT) is transforming freight monitoring. IoT-enabled containers can provide real-time tracking info and environmental information (such as temperature level and humidity) for delicate cargo.
- Blockchain: This innovation provides safe and secure, tamper-proof records of deals and ownership, improving transparency in the supply chain and possibly minimizing fraud.
- Automation and AI: Automation in warehouses and ports accelerate the processing of containers, while AI examines shipping patterns to enhance performance.
Obstacles in Freight Container Shipping
In spite of their many advantages, freight containers deal with a number of difficulties that market stakeholders must deal with:

- Port Congestion: Increased shipping traffic can cause blockage at ports, delaying the dumping and transport of containers.
- Regulatory Issues: Compliance with different worldwide Shipping Container Architecture laws and policies can be complicated and may prevent effectiveness.
- Risk of Damage: While containers are robust, they can still sustain damage from rough handling, adverse weather condition, or improper stacking.
